COTTON USA Special Trade Mission from Bangladesh & Pakistan
July 24-August 3, 2010
A delegation of textile representatives from Bangladesh and Pakistan will meet with U.S. industry officials during an upcoming COTTON USA Special Trade Mission. The group will tour the U.S. Cotton Belt—including a farm, gin and classing office—with stops at major growing, research and trading centers. The delegation will meet with the following organizations: American Cotton Shippers Association (ACSA), the American Cotton Marketing Cooperatives (AMCOT), American Cotton Producers, Cotton Incorporated, ICE Futures U.S., the Lubbock Cotton Exchange, the National Cotton Council, Plains Cotton Growers Association, San Joaquin Valley Quality Cotton Growers Association, Southern Cotton Growers Association, Supima, the Texas Cotton Association, Texas Cotton Producers, the U.S. Department of Agriculture and the Western Cotton Shippers Association.
